refactor: flatten CLI directory structure - remove 'box in a box'
BEFORE: /opt/aitbc/cli/ ├── aitbc_cli/ # Python package (box in a box) │ ├── commands/ │ ├── main.py │ └── ... ├── setup.py AFTER: /opt/aitbc/cli/ # Flat structure ├── commands/ # Direct access ├── main.py # Direct access ├── auth/ ├── config/ ├── core/ ├── models/ ├── utils/ ├── plugins.py └── setup.py CHANGES MADE: - Moved all files from aitbc_cli/ to cli/ root - Fixed all relative imports (from . to absolute imports) - Updated setup.py entry point: aitbc_cli.main → main - Added CLI directory to Python path in entry script - Simplified deployment.py to remove dependency on deleted core.deployment - Fixed import paths in all command files - Recreated virtual environment with new structure BENEFITS: - Eliminated 'box in a box' nesting - Simpler directory structure - Direct access to all modules - Cleaner imports - Easier maintenance and development - CLI works with both 'python main.py' and 'aitbc' commands
